Product Overview
3,5-Difluoropyridine-4-carboxylic acid is a high-value fluorinated heterocyclic carboxylic acid widely employed as a key building block in modern medicinal chemistry. With its dual fluorine substitution pattern and carboxylic acid functionality at the 4-position of the pyridine ring, this compound offers exceptional reactivity and selectivity in cross-coupling, amidation, and derivatization reactions. It serves as a critical intermediate in the synthesis of complex pharmaceutical active ingredients targeting diverse therapeutic areas.
Specifications
| CAS Number | 903522-29-2 |
|---|---|
| Molecular Formula | C6H3F2NO2 |
| Molecular Weight | 159.09 g/mol |
| Appearance | Yellow liquid |
| Purity | ≥99.0% |
| Density | 1.535 g/cm³ |
| Boiling Point | 316.9°C at 760 mmHg |
| Flash Point | 145.5°C |
| Refractive Index | 1.515 |
Industrial Applications
This fluorinated pyridine derivative is primarily utilized in the pharmaceutical industry as a versatile synthetic intermediate. Its unique electronic and steric properties enable the construction of structurally complex molecules with improved metabolic stability, bioavailability, and target affinity. Common applications include:
- Synthesis of kinase inhibitors and other targeted oncology therapeutics
- Development of central nervous system (CNS) agents requiring enhanced blood-brain barrier penetration
- Preparation of anti-infective scaffolds leveraging fluorine’s influence on lipophilicity
- Building block for agrochemical research and specialty materials
